If you don't do it "The SQL way" you'll probably get into trouble with duplicate key values for the primary key index in your spatialite tables.

I assume:

 * That your tables - let's call them TABLE_A and TABLE_B has exactly
   the same structure
 * All tables has a integer primary key column - lets call it OGC_FID
 * You want to add the rows of TABLE_B to TABLE_A

The you can do the following:

1. Open the dbmanager in QGis (*Menu Database* --> *DB Manager* --> *DB
   manager*). QGIS shows a dialog-window "DB Manager"
2. *Double-click* on the spatialite database you want to work with in
   the selection tree (left side of the "DB Manager" dialog) and push
   the *F2* on the keyboard. QGis shows another dialog-window "SQL
   window - /database name/"
3. Write "*select max (OGC_FID) from TABLE_A"* in the "query" window
   and push the *F5* button to execute the query. Remember the result
   value.
4. Write "*update* *TABLE_B set OGC_FID = OGC_FID + */maxA/*+ 1" *in
   the "query" window and push the *F5* button to execute the query*.
   First *replace /maxA /with the found value from step 3. This query
   will guarantee, that there is no identical OGC_FID values in the two
   tables.
5. Write *"insert into TABLE_A select * from TABLE_B"* in the "query"
   window and push the *F5* button to execute the query. This query
   will copy the rows from TABLE_B and append them to TABLE_A.
6. Repeat steps 3 - 5 and replace TABLE_B with the names of the other
   tables you want to add to TABLE_A.

Tip: Write all the SQL commands into a text-editor (ex. notepad) and copy-paste them one-by-one into the query window. It can save you for a lot of grief.

I have a number of spatial tables in spatialite DB, each with similar
data, that I want to merge into a single table. I don't want to join
them, but have a single table/view with data from all tables.

I know this can be achieved through sql commands, but is there an easy
(GUI) way to insert content from one table into another?
